/home/docs/checkouts/readthedocs.org/user_builds/ratpac/checkouts/latest/src/geo/include/RAT/GeoPerfBoxFactory.hh Source File

Ratpac-two: /home/docs/checkouts/readthedocs.org/user_builds/ratpac/checkouts/latest/src/geo/include/RAT/GeoPerfBoxFactory.hh Source File
Ratpac-two
GeoPerfBoxFactory.hh
1 /* Creates a rectangular solid with a set of holes punched out.
2  */
3 
4 #ifndef __RAT_GeoPerfBoxFactory__
5 #define __RAT_GeoPerfBoxFactory__
6 
7 #include <G4VSolid.hh>
8 #include <RAT/DB.hh>
9 #include <RAT/GeoSolidFactory.hh>
10 
11 namespace RAT {
13  public:
14  GeoPerfBoxFactory() : GeoSolidFactory("perfbox"){};
15  virtual G4VSolid *ConstructSolid(DBLinkPtr table);
16 };
17 
18 } // namespace RAT
19 
20 #endif
Definition: GeoPerfBoxFactory.hh:12
Definition: GeoSolidFactory.hh:8
Definition: CCCrossSecMessenger.hh:29